Getting There

  • Car

    If you're traveling by car, start from the main entrance of Serra dos Órgãos National Park located in Petrópolis. Drive towards the BR-040 highway and take the exit towards Itaipava. Follow the signs to Itaipava, and then navigate to Rua do Imperador, which will lead you to the central area of Itaipava. Continue on this road until you reach the sign for Vale do Cuiabá, which is located just outside of the main town. The drive should take about 30 minutes, depending on traffic.

  • Public Transportation

    To reach Vale do Cuiabá using public transportation, first take a bus from the main bus terminal in Petrópolis headed towards Itaipava. Buses run frequently; check the local schedule for exact times. Once you arrive in Itaipava, you can either take a taxi or use a local ride-sharing service to reach Vale do Cuiabá. The taxi ride from Itaipava to the entrance of Vale do Cuiabá should take approximately 10-15 minutes and cost around BRL 20-30.

  • Hiking

    For the adventurous, you can also hike to Vale do Cuiabá once you reach the main entrance of Serra dos Órgãos National Park. There are designated trails that guide you through the beautiful landscapes. Ensure to wear proper hiking gear and bring water. The hike can take anywhere from 1.5 to 3 hours, depending on your pace. Make sure to check the trail conditions at the park entrance.

Discover more about Vale do Cuiabá

Vale do Cuiabá, situated in the charming district of Itaipava in Petrópolis, State of Rio de Janeiro, is a hidden gem that beckons nature lovers and adventure seekers alike. This stunning destination is renowned for its breathtaking views, lush greenery, and tranquil atmosphere, making it an ideal spot for those looking to escape the hustle and bustle of urban life. As you wander through the vale, you'll be greeted by a symphony of sounds from the diverse wildlife that calls this enchanting place home. The vibrant flora and fauna create a picturesque backdrop for hiking, picnicking, or simply soaking in the natural beauty that surrounds you. Visitors to Vale do Cuiabá can immerse themselves in its serene environment, where the air is fresh and invigorating. The area is excellent for leisurely walks or more challenging hikes, catering to all levels of outdoor enthusiasts. Along the trails, you may stumble upon hidden waterfalls and serene streams, perfect for a refreshing dip on warmer days. The peacefulness of the vale is enhanced by its gentle slopes and the soft rustle of leaves, making it a perfect spot for meditation or relaxation. For those looking to capture the beauty of Vale do Cuiabá, photography opportunities abound; every corner offers a new perspective of this stunning landscape. Additionally, the proximity to Itaipava means that you can easily explore local dining and shopping options after a day of adventure in the vale. With its combination of natural beauty and accessibility, Vale do Cuiabá is a must-visit destination for anyone traveling to the Petrópolis area.
